Tough River Decision
 
Playing a $1/$2 No Limit table with $200 max buy in. I just sat down so i have no reads on anyone besides the villian whom ive seen around. Villian in this hand seems to play a lot, and it seems like he does well (this could be wrong).

Anyway, i post a blind in late position and get a beautiful T [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img]7 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img].

There are 6 people to see the flop.

Flop comes: T [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]

SB checks, BB checks, UTG+1 bets $2 (he also just sat down adn posted preflop) i raise to $8. SB, BB and UTG call.

Turn: (T [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]) 2 [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img]
Checked to UTG+1 who bets $10 i raise to $30. Only BB and UTG+1 call.

River: (T [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] 2 [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img]) A [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]
BB quickly goes all in for $130. UTG+1 folds.. option on me??? What to do? There is around $135 already in the pot before the river card so im getting 2:1 on my call. Would you call and what do you think villian has?

Re: Tough River Decision
 
He could have A10 or Ax spades with or without a 2 or a 7. Barring reads I fold as I do not wish to go broke in an unraised pot. He could also have 89o (he was the BB after all).

Still the likelyhood of Ax spades makes this not a clear decision either way.
